Never touch this machine without training and authorization from your supervisor.
Guards must be in place before plugging in and turning on the machine.
Always keep your fingers, hands and clothing away from sharp or moving parts.

  • Page 2 Cleaning Procedure Use the following steps to start the cleaning procedure. 1. Press the button on the display. Cleaning Figure 2. Cleaning and Start Buttons 2. Press the button on the display. The machine takes approximately 10 seconds to fully move Start into cleaning mode.
